如何实现"mysql ABORT_SERVER"报错

流程图

flowchart TD;
    A[连接数据库] --> B[执行SQL语句] --> C[触发ABORT_SERVER报错] --> D[处理错误]

操作步骤

步骤 操作
1 连接数据库
2 执行SQL语句
3 触发ABORT_SERVER报错
4 处理错误

详细操作

  1. 连接数据库
# 代码示例
```python
import mysql.connector

# 连接数据库
mydb = mysql.connector.connect(
  host="localhost",
  user="root",
  password="password",
  database="mydatabase"
)

# 获取游标
mycursor = mydb.cursor()
  1. 执行SQL语句
# 代码示例
```python
# 执行SQL语句
sql = "SELECT * FROM customers WHERE address = 'Park Lane 38'"
mycursor.execute(sql)

# 获取结果
myresult = mycursor.fetchall()
  1. 触发ABORT_SERVER报错
# 代码示例
```python
# 触发ABORT_SERVER报错
try:
    sql = "ABORT_SERVER"
    mycursor.execute(sql)
except Exception as e:
    print("Error:", e)
  1. 处理错误
# 代码示例
```python
# 处理错误
mydb.rollback()

通过以上操作,你可以成功触发"mysql ABORT_SERVER"报错,并且正确处理错误,确保数据库操作的稳定性和数据完整性。祝你学习顺利,编程愉快!